Here are some tips for cleaning and maintaining terracotta tiles:
- Sweep or vacuum your terracotta tiles regularly to remove dirt and dust.
- Mop your terracotta tiles with a damp mop and a mild cleaner.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ners, as these can damage the tiles.
- If you spill something on your terracotta tiles, blot it up immediately with a clean cloth. Do not rub, as this can spread the stain.
- Seal your terracotta tiles every few years to protect them from stains and wear and tear.
By following these tips, you can keep your terracotta tiles looking beautiful for many years to come.
3. Aesthetics
The aesthetic versatility of terracotta tiles is a key factor in their popularity for kitchen flooring. Terracotta tiles come in a wide range of colors, from natural reddish-brown tones to brighter colors such as yellow, orange, and green. They can also be glazed or unglazed, and they can be used to create a variety of patterns and designs.
This versatility makes terracotta tiles a good choice for kitchens of any style. For example, natural terracotta tiles can be used to create a warm and inviting traditional kitchen, while glazed terracotta tiles can be used to create a more modern look. Terracotta tiles can also be used to create a rustic or Mediterranean-style kitchen.
